surreptitious
[ˌsʌrəpˈtɪʃəs]
adjective
  1. kept secret, especially because it would not be approved of
    私下的;偷偷摸摸的(尤指因为不会被批准)
    low wages were supplemented by surreptitious payments from tradesmen.
    商人私下付的报酬补充了低工资。
派生
surreptitiously
adverb
surreptitiousness
noun
语源
  1. late Middle English (in the sense 'obtained by suppression of the truth'): from Latin surreptitius (from the verb surripere, from sub- 'secretly' + rapere 'seize') + -ous
